
Coming off the bench during Borussia Dortmund’s 0-0 draw with Fluminense in the FIFA Club World Cup on Tuesday night, Jobe Bellingham made his debut for the Bundesliga team. Only weeks after leading Sunderland back to the Premier League through the Championship playoffs, the midfield player relocated to Germany earlier this month.
He had established himself as a vital member of the Black Cats, but instead of staying at the Stadium of Light and trying to get them into the top division the next season, he decided to follow in his older brother’s footsteps and relocate to Dortmund. Even though he doesn’t have the Bellingham name on the back of his shirt, he is still very much associated with Jude, his older brother, who rose to fame at Signal Iduna Park before moving to Real Madrid in 2023.
Following his debut for the team, fans have been talking about the younger sibling on social media, and they are hoping he can duplicate some of that magic in Germany.
